首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以理程序的输出结果______。 main() { char st[20]="he11\O\t\\"; printf("%d%d\n",str1en (st),sizeof(st)); }
以理程序的输出结果______。 main() { char st[20]="he11\O\t\\"; printf("%d%d\n",str1en (st),sizeof(st)); }
admin
2010-09-05
56
问题
以理程序的输出结果______。 main() { char st[20]="he11\O\t\\"; printf("%d%d\n",str1en (st),sizeof(st)); }
选项
A、99
B、520
C、1320
D、2020
答案
B
解析
C语言中字符串是以’\O’字符结束的,且strlen()函数计算的是’\O’字符前的所有字符的个数。本题中strlen(st)应为5。数组定义以后系统就为其分配相应大小的内存空间,而不论其中有没有内容。sizeof()函数是计算变量或数组的所分配到的内存空间的大小。所以本题的sizeof(st)为20。
转载请注明原文地址:https://kaotiyun.com/show/0uWp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
窗体上有1个名称为Command1的命令按钮;1个名称为List1、没有列表项的列表框。编写如下程序:PrivateSubCommand1_Click()DimxAsString,sAsString,tempAsString
下列关于通用对话框CommonDialog1的叙述中,错误的是( )。
三角形的构成条件是:任意2边之和大于第3边。设变量a、b、c是3条直线的长度,要求判断这3条直线能否构成一个三角形。下面有3个程序段可以正确判断,另一个不能正确判断的是
以下变量名q1合法的是()。
编写程序,要求输入一个正整数,计算各位数字之和,并将计算结果显示在窗体上。程序如下:PrivateSubCommand1_Click()DimSumAsInteger,kAsLongk=Val(InputBox("
一个工程中包含两个名称分别为Form1、Form2的窗体、一个名称为Func的标准模块。假定在Form1、Form2和Func中分别建立了自定义过程,其定义格式为:Form1中定义的过程:PrivateSubFunl()EndSubForm2
如果要定义一个窗体级变量,定义变量语句的位置应该是
假定有以下函数过程:FunctionFun(SAsString)AsString Dims1AsString Fori=1ToLen(S) s1=LCase(Mid(S,i,1))+s1 Nexti
设A、B、C是三角形的3条边,则以下表示"任意两边之和大于第三边"的布尔表达式是
数据结构主要研宄的是数据的逻辑结构、数据的运算和()。
随机试题
没有行政强制执行权的行政机关应当申请人民法院强制执行。但是,当事人在法定期限内不申请行政复议或者提起行政诉讼,经催告仍不履行的,在实施行政管理过程中已经采取查封、扣押措施的行政机关,可以将查封、扣押的财物依法拍卖抵缴罚款()
上课是整个教学工作的中心环节。()
AbbySubarkisamotheroftwokidsfromBoston."Formykids,I’mnervous.Idon’tknowifthey’llbeabletoachievetheir
根据患者获得感染危险性的程度,医院可分成4个区域:低危险区域、中等危险区域、()和()。
由发包人采购承包人安装的设备,试车检验发现设备制造质量较差需更换,则该事件的处理方式应为()。
伴随着留学需求的增加以及留学信息的泛滥,在留学市场难免出现一些错误的导向信息。这其中存在着对外国学校的过分褒奖以及对外国考试性质的夸大诠释,还有因为语言和文化背景的不同而产生的对院校性质的误读。如何鉴别这些留学信息成了家长及学生的一项重要的预备课。在多年对
设平面区域D由曲线y=,y=1围成,则(xy3-1)dσ等于()
在数据流图(DFD)中,带有名字的箭头表示()。
A、Lendingcovenantsnowareoftenmadeatcompoundinterest.B、Lendingtransactionsnowareoftenmadeatcompoundinterest.C、L
In1998,tomanywesterners’surprise,HongKongcarried______theeconomiccrisis.
最新回复
(
0
)